The O Antiphons

The O Antiphons are used during that last seven days of Advent during the evening service and begin with the vocative particle “O.”Each antiphon is a name of Christ along with one of his attributes from Scripture.

Sermon: Look Forward

Prophets say things no one wants to hear. Prophets point to the uncomfortable truth about people and the world around them. Prophets call people out for bad behavior and when they are causing others to skew their actions and beliefs. Prophets point us in directions that we do not always want to look and call us to things we do not always want to do.
